Jackpot (British comics)

Annuals were printed from 1980 to 1986 - as was often the case with British titles, these hardback books outlasted the weekly comic by some time.

They mixed original and reprinted material, with much of the new material being drawn by different artists than the weekly strips due to the lower page rate paid to artists.

Summer Specials were printed from 1980 to 1982, again mixing reprint material with new strips (which again featured different artists).
